snoopy123123, Welcome to RoombaReview!! :D
It depends on a few things why the Scooba might leave more water than usual. First off, you want to make sure the rubber vacuum port and metal filter are seated correctly. When you put on the tank and snap it shut, it should be level/flush with the body. Second, Make sure underneath the rubber squeegees are straight and not wavy. Pull them until they are straight. Third is geographic location. Do you live where it's humid? If so, then there will be more water on the floor. Less humid=quicker evaporation. |

| Depending on the run and if you use soft water, there might be some clean solution in the clean tank. I rinse out both tanks with close to hot water and swish it around a few times to make sure to get out the gunk. Then I leave both flaps open and store the tank off of the Scooba between missions so it has a chance to dry out. |
